Travel ban imposed on 8 directors of Prochhaya Limited

BSS
Published On: 29 Apr 2025, 15:59

DHAKA, April 29, 2025 (BSS) - A court here today imposed a travel ban on eight directors of Prochhaya Limited over their involvement in alleged embezzlement of around Taka 59,000 crore from the construction of the Rooppur Nuclear Power Plant (NPP) by ousted prime minister Sheikh Hasina and her family members.

The eight people, who have been barred by the court from leaving the country, are Shaheen Siddique, Bushra Siddique, Shehtaj Munnasi Khan, Shahid Uddin Khan, Shafik Ahmed, Parija Painaj Khan, Naorin Tasmia Siddique and Farjana Anjum.

Dhaka Metropolitan Senior Special Judge Md Zakir Hossain Galib passed the order, allowing an appeal of the Anti-Corruption Commission (ACC).

The anti-graft body in its plea said it has already formed a seven-member probe team to investigate and submit report on allegations of embezzlement of around Taka 59,000 crore from the construction of the Rooppur Nuclear Power Plant (NPP) by Sheikh Hasina, her son Sajeeb Wazed Joy, sister Sheikh Rehana, niece Tulip Siddique and others.

"The directors of Prochhaya Limited have links with this and if they manage to leave the country, the probe team would face difficulties in getting the necessary evidences, which can eventually hamper the probe," the ACC plea said.
